About

Amir Karniel is a leading researcher in motor control, haptic perception, and human-robot interaction, whose work bridges computational neuroscience and robotics. His most influential contribution is the exploration of how the motor control system uses multiple models and context switching to cope with variable environments—a 2002 paper that has garnered 142 citations and remains foundational in the field. He pioneered the concept of a Turing-like handshake test to assess motor intelligence, demonstrating whether robots can produce movements indistinguishable from those of humans (63 citations). Karniel has also made seminal contributions to understanding the perception of delayed stiffness in teleoperation, revealing how the brain constructs internal representations of haptic environments (90 citations). His analytical work on perceptual and motor transparency in bilateral teleoperation (50 citations) has advanced the design of more intuitive robotic interfaces. Beyond these, he has developed neuro-robotic systems using lamprey brainstems to study neural dynamics and plasticity (33 citations). Karniel’s research consistently challenges assumptions about sensorimotor control, offering deep insights into how the brain represents time, stiffness, and environmental uncertainty—work that has profound implications for prosthetics, virtual reality, and human-robot collaboration.
